Hey folks,

So I have a Sony FDR AX700 handicam. I primarily use this camera to capture zoomed in footage for my YouTube videos which are not weather related. I mainly use the GoPro 8 for all my filming because its small and it is so stable!! But I video venomous snakes and the zoom function allows me to get inches away from a rattlesnake without getting "poop my pants" close enough! ;)

Anyways...

I might locally chase here and there if I get a bug in me to do it.

So for that particular camera, is there a good mount that any of you would recommend to be able to mount inside my vehicle? Preferably to view out the front windshield?
 
I have the Gripper 115 for the one I had before I sold the AX100 (which is about the same size) and it works perfectly. You can get them online for about 80-100 bucks I believe. They are pretty solid, reliable, and durable. I've had mine for about 8 years and it's still going strong!

The Gripper 115 is the one that I use routinely and it has performed nothing short of superior.

One thing to mention is, if you have the slightest crack in a windshield from hail / debris, the suction cup mount for the Gripper 115 is extremely powerful It will cause a crack to spread to that area nearly instantly as I so recently found out, and once the crack invades the surface space where the mount attaches to the windshield, it will not hold vacuum at all, so be mindful of this.
